Scientific Abstract

The increasing individualization due to customer-specific requirements as well as the enormous complexity of modern products lead to steadily increasing challenges in product development. The key task of product developers is to meet the steadily increasing requirements from the product life cycle for technical products. For this purpose, multi-criteria evaluations of solution variants in product development (e.g. different concepts, drafts, elaborations) are very important. However, there is currently the risk that decisive requirements for the evaluation of the alternative solution variants are taken not or not adequately into account and thus the product quality suffers.The overall objective of the research project is a multi-criteria, computer-supported evaluation process of solution variants with regard to all requirements from the product life cycle. The first sub-goal is the mathematical description of the relations between all requirements as well as the evaluation criteria derived therefrom and the related product properties and characteristics. The second sub-goal is the development of computer-aided methods for the analysis, visualization and evaluation of solution variants by means of value functions for the quantified description of the relations between requirements, product properties and characteristics. This is particularly useful for more targeted and systematic evaluation and decision-making in the different development phases. The scientific claim is the development of a procedure with suitable modeling, analysis and visualization methods. This result in a requirement-oriented evaluation with regard to all requirements arising from the product lifecycle and the evaluation criteria derived from it.
